Real-Time Traffic on Google Maps

Fileradar.nl

Developed by two students at the Technical University of Delft, Fileradar.nl shows real-time traffic information for the area in and around Rotterdam, Netherlands.

The map combines a traffic model with different measurement sources to show the current road conditions. Unlike many traffic models Fileradar.nl does not use past traffic patterns to predict the present road conditions. Instead they look at the present road conditions and use their own algorithms to predict how the traffic will develop.

The Google Map shows in red the areas that are showing traffic congestion. The map animates through from the present time to an hour and a half later to show you how the traffic is likely to develop.
